Output 31e03228e19ea832652afb5568257facd1096abef4681322e79508e85125b669:0

value
348228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7e5d04df2feb5cce25acb177b86d58e1a1c58ba OP_EQUAL
address
3NqBKbGaVF2zoU2XyKfA5rU1giYxBC6xrW
transaction
31e03228e19ea832652afb5568257facd1096abef4681322e79508e85125b669
spent
true